Crystal Palace and Sunderland have both agreed deals to sign Malick Fofana, leaving the winger at the centre of a transfer tug-of-war with his next destination still to be decided on Deadline Day.

Fofana had looked set to join Sunderland after the Black Cats made significant progress in their pursuit of the 20-year-old, who had also attracted interest from Arsenal. Sky Sports News understands Fofana was at Lyon airport on Tuesday afternoon with two private jets waiting for him to make his decision - one bound for London and the other for Sunderland.

The extraordinary situation has developed after Palace moved to swoop in on Sunderland's deal for the 20-year-old, who had been expected to join the Black Cats after they agreed terms with Lyon earlier on Tuesday. Sunderland's agreement is worth up to £30m, comprising a £25.7m fixed fee plus £4.3m in add-ons. Fofana had been given permission to travel for a medical after Sunderland reached their agreement with Lyon and had a five-year contract ready for him.

Palace have now secured their own club-to-club agreement with Lyon and are working on the formalities of the transfer. However, the Black Cats have been given hope that their deal to sign the winger is still alive.

Sunderland are also pressing ahead with an alternative deal should their move for Fofana ultimately fall through. They are in talks with Benfica for Dodi Lukebakio, although their preference remains to discover whether Fofana will choose Sunderland or Palace. Sunderland had been exploring moves for Jack Grealish and Igor Paixao as they looked to strengthen their attack before Tuesday's transfer deadline.

They had made an offer for Brazilian winger Paixao, which was rejected by Marseille, with negotiations proving difficult. There was also a belief that Grealish would prefer to remain in the north west, with the Manchester City player in talks with Everton. That led Sunderland to consider Fofana as a viable alternative.

On Monday, Fofana remained an option for Sunderland going into Deadline Day amid the belief that Paixao would stay at Marseille. The situation then moved quickly on Tuesday morning with Sunderland agreeing a deal with Lyon for Fofana, and the winger given permission to travel for a medical and a five-year contract expected to follow. Arsenal had also been interested in the Belgian winger.
